Home Price Trends — Northampton, MA
As of Oct '25, the median home price in Northampton, MA is $437,000, with a year-over-year change of -0.7%. This indicates that home prices in Northampton, MA are flat. According to Zillow, the 1-year price projection is 1.5%, suggesting an increase housing market in the next year.
Cost per Home Type
| Home Type | Median Home Value | YoY % Change |
|---|---|---|
All Homes | $437,000 | -0.7% |
| Single Family | $505,000 | -0.8% |
| Condos | $371,000 | 0.5% |

Property Listings — Northampton, MA
As of Oct '25, Realtor.com reports that the median days on market for a home in Northampton, MA is 28. This is a decrease of -54.0% from last year, suggesting that homes are sitting on the market shorter than last year. The percentage of listed homes with a reduced price is 33.0%, representing a large inventory and a lot of supply pressure on home prices.
| Metric | Zip Code Average | Year over Year % Change |
|---|---|---|
Median Listing Price | $417,000 | -10.0% |
Listing Count | 6 | -25.0% |
| Listings as % of Homes | 0.1% | -25.0% |
Days on Market | 28 | -54.0% |
Demographics — Northampton, MA
As of the latest ACS Survey released in 2023, Northampton, MA has a population of 2,030, which has increased by 19.4% over the past 5 years. Northampton, MA is a less popular place for families, as children make up 10.2% of the population. The area has a highly educated workforce, with 53.7% of adult residents holding a bachelor’s degree or higher. There are some residents working remotely, with 19.0% reporting working from home.
| Metric | Latest Census | YoY % Change |
|---|---|---|
Population | 2,030 | 19.4% |
% Under 18 | 10.2% | -33.3% |
% Seniors | 35.1% | 31.0% |
% WFH | 19.0% | 137.5% |
% w/ College Degree | 53.7% | 19.6% |
As of the latest ACS Survey released in 2023, Northampton, MA is a predominantly white area, with 85.1% of the population identifying as white. The white population has shrunk by 5.7% in the last 5 years. The second most common race or ethnicity in Northampton, MA is black, making up 8.1% of the population. Foreign-born residents account for 12.3% of the population in Northampton, MA, and this percentage has increased by 261.8% as of the ACS Survey 5 years prior, suggesting more immigrants are calling the area home.
Race and Ethnicity
| Metric | Latest Census | 5-Year % Change |
|---|---|---|
% White | 85.1% | -5.7% |
% Black | 8.1% | 107.7% |
% Hispanic | 4.1% | -16.3% |
% Asian | 0.9% | 50.0% |
% Foreign Born | 12.3% | 261.8% |
Mortgage and Risk — Northampton, MA
According to HUD data as of 2023, there were 52 mortgage originations in Northampton, MA, of which 92.0% of loans were conventional mortgages. The average loan-to-value was 48.0%, with 4.0% above 90% LTV (normal). This implies small mortgage risk in Northampton, MA. Investor activity is low, as 2.0% of loans were by investors. 15.0% of loans were cash-out refinances, suggesting many homeowners are tapping equity.
Mortgages
| Metric | Zip Code Average |
|---|---|
Total Loan Originations | 52 |
% Conventional Loans | 92.0% |
% Government Loans | 8.0% |
% Investor Loans | 2.0% |
% Second Loans | 0.0% |
% Cash Out Refinance | 15.0% |
